Sephora is a beauty supply store and they offer a box of 6 sample sized items for $10 a month subscription, named Play! When you sign up you are asked questions regarding your skin and hair traits as well as your concerns, they take that into account and send you products that basically line up. Starting out the first noticeable thing about this box is the packaging! The drawstring bag that normally welcomes the opening of the box was replaced by a reusable plastic bag. I wasn't sure what to think, but knowing that I never really know what to do with the bags besides donate them, this seems welcome. The bag says its 100% recyclable, so that's a step in the right direction. I think that I will keep this bag around for a bit, I think it will come in handy for travel, and even just taking the occasional product in my purse to work or the gym. Time will tell!

My box contains Nomade Eau De Parfum by Chloe, Make Up For Ever Ultra HD Perfector Skin Tint Foundation, Too Faced Hangover Replenishing Face Primer, Sephora's LashCraft Big Volume Mascara, Peter Thomas Roth Hungarian Thermal Water Mineral-Rich Atomic Heat Mask, and Boscia Cactus Water Moisturizer.

Hands down the thing I am most excited to try is the Too Faced Primer, I have seen it around, but have just never tried it. I still haven't found a primer that is my holy grail, and on an everyday routine just consider my extensive skin care routine my primer.

Nomade has a light fresh scent that smells like there is a warm, flowery, candle melting near by. I think it would be hard to find this overwhelming. Nice and pleasant.

The Ultra HD Foundation seems nice. Its doesn't have a strong smell that some foundations have. I think this color might match me based on the small swatch that I did. It looks like a light to medium coverage. I really like that it also has an SPF of 25 built in. Save steps, save time, save your skin!

Sephora's LashCraft Mascara has really cute packaging. This is in the color noir, black. The packaging says its made with jojoba oil and is supposed to be nourishing while allowing you to build up coverage without all the fallout and clumping. I must admit, I tried Hourglass' Caution Mascara and haven't looked back, but I am totally willing to give this a try especially with the price difference.

I am a sucker for anything "anti-aging" so this has my name all over it! This is a pale-translucent gel. It claims to help with wrinkles, dullness, skin tone, and texture. Sounds like something I would want to bathe in. I have high hopes for this and can't wait to see how it preforms.

I have combination leaning towards oily skin and avoided any type of moisturizer for the first twenty or so years of my life. I slowly added it in, and now I am at the point in my life that I realize how important moisture is and am so excited to try Boscia Cactus Water! This has a translucent mint green color, with a clean, refreshing scent.
